Sixers’ Danny Green attracting interest from Bucks, Celtics, Bulls, and Pelicans
Posted Aug 4, 2021
As of midday Tuesday, the 76ers and Danny Green were nowhere close to a deal that would keep him with the team. This comes after both sides had spoken multiple times over a 24-hour span. Representatives from the Milwaukee Bucks, Boston Celtics, Chicago Bulls, and New Orleans Pelicans have reached out to the Sixers free-agent small forward.
